A digital twin is a virtual model that accurately reflects a physical object. Attached sensors on the physical object, produce data, such as energy output, temperature, weather conditions and more.

In this video, Jernej Kavka (JK) sits down with Priyanka Shah to show why your digital twin can help your organisation to achieve sustainability goals and better management.
